This paper presents new techniques for the trajectory design and control of nonlinear dynamical systems. The technique uses a convex polytope to bound the range of the nonlinear function and associates with each vertex an auxiliary linear system. Provided controls associated with the linear systems can be generated to satisfy an ordering constraint, the nonlinear control is computable by the interpolation of controls obtained by convex optimization. This theoretical result leads to two numerical approaches for solving the nonlinear constrained problem: one requires solving a single convex optimization problem and the other requires solving a sequence of convex optimization problems. The approaches are applied to two practical problems in aerospace engineering: a constrained relative orbital motion problem and an attitude control problem. The solve times for both problems and approaches are on the order of seconds. It is concluded that these techniques are rigorous and of practical use in solving nonlinear trajectory design and control problems.
This paper presents a solution strategy for deterministic time-optimal pursuit–evasion games with linear state constraints, convex control constraints, and linear dynamics that is consistent with linearized relative orbital motion models such as the Clohessy–Wiltshire equations and relative orbital elements. The strategy first generates polytopic inner approximations of the players’ reachable sets by solving a sequence of convex programs. A bisection method then computes the optimal termination time, which is the least time at which a set containment condition is satisfied. The pursuit–evasion games considered are games with (1) a single pursuer and single evader, (2) multiple pursuers and a single evader, and (3) a single pursuer and multiple evaders. Compared to variational methods, this reachable set strategy leads to a tractable formulation even when there are state and control constraints. The efficacy of the strategy is demonstrated in three numerical simulations for a constellation of satellites in close proximity in low earth orbit.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.